Output 508e77429dbf707aa30ca0df126cd0c1747562011d1dab12e35c6e0599b06ceb:0

value
47000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 49736baa70c72b9177765116a2335e2163c0f586 OP_EQUALVERIFY OP_CHECKSIG
address
17hNbZnwKxHJjfq6UFAXPCZ1DCuhb2Ppk3
transaction
508e77429dbf707aa30ca0df126cd0c1747562011d1dab12e35c6e0599b06ceb
spent
true